Output 531669a7684d5acfc76201330a30a0e0aa5cbce4e69650f54fc68d11412f9f0d:2

value
59049
script pubkey
OP_0 OP_PUSHBYTES_20 1eb26f84fad7ddbbf790104fe86ece49e42035a8
address
bc1qr6exlp866lwmhauszp87smkwf8jzqddgfjsxuy
transaction
531669a7684d5acfc76201330a30a0e0aa5cbce4e69650f54fc68d11412f9f0d
spent
true